Daniel Cortez Jr., 57, of Kerrville, Texas passed away on May 3, 2025, in Kerr County. He was born in Hondo, Texas on January 7, 1968, to Danny Cortez Sr., and Gloria Cortez and married to Joan Pullin Cortez on March 11, 2001.

Daniel is a 1986 graduate of Tivy High School. He obtained a Bachelor's Degree from Texas A&M. Most recently he was a member of the Actors Guild and The Mounted Peace Officer Association. He was also a RadioDJ for 92.3 The Ranch and KRVL 94 Country. He was a devout follower of Jesus Christ finding comfort and wisdom in the Bible.

Daniel was preceded in death by Landon T. Cortez (Grandson).

He is survived by Danny Cortez Sr. (Father), Gloria R. Cortez (Mother), Joan L. Cortez (Wife), Daniel J. Cortez (Oldest Son), Kimberly S. Cortez (Daughter-in-law) John A. Cortez (Youngest Son), Daren Cortez (Younger Brother), Loreta B. Cortez (Sister-in-law), Lori R. Cortez (Niece), Megan Pullin-Atkinson (Sister-in-law), Jeffery R. Atkinson (Brother-in-law), Harper Lynn (Granddaughter), Harlow Ann (Granddaughter), Kyrenna Amelia (Granddaughter), Karliah Aurora (Granddaughter), and William Riker (Grandson).

Services will be held at 10am on Wednesday May 14, 2025, at Calvary Temple Church. Del Way and Joe Taylor will officiate. Burial will follow at Garden of Memories.
